Magento 2 Bố cục tùy chỉnh cho danh mục

Phần Thiết kế cho phép bạn kiểm soát giao diện của danh mục, tất cả các trang sản phẩm được liên kết và bố cục trang. Bạn có thể tùy chỉnh trang danh mục và các sản phẩm được liên kết với nó để quảng cáo hoặc để phân biệt danh mục. Ví dụ: bạn có thể phát triển một thiết kế đặc biệt cho một thương hiệu hoặc dòng sản phẩm đặc biệt hoặc áp dụng bản cập nhật cho một khoảng thời gian cụ thể

Khi cùng một sản phẩm được chỉ định cho một số danh mục với các cài đặt thiết kế khác nhau cho từng danh mục, bạn nên đặt Sử dụng Đường dẫn Danh mục cho URL Sản phẩm = Yes trong. Để truy cập cài đặt này, hãy đi tới Cửa hàng > Cài đặt > Cấu hình, mở rộng Danh mục và chọn Danh mục bên dưới trong bảng điều khiển bên trái, sau đó mở rộng phần Tối ưu hóa Công cụ Tìm kiếm trên trang

FieldDescriptionSử dụng cài đặt danh mục chínhCho phép danh mục hiện tại kế thừa cài đặt thiết kế từ danh mục chính. Nếu được sử dụng, tất cả các trường khác trong phần Thiết kế sẽ không khả dụng. Tùy chọn. Yes / NoChủ đềÁp dụng chủ đề tùy chỉnh cho danh mục. Bố cụcÁp dụng bố cục khác cho trang danh mục. Tùy chọn
Không cập nhật bố cục - Theo mặc định, cập nhật bố cục không có sẵn cho các trang danh mục
Empty - Sử dụng để xác định bố cục trang của riêng bạn. [Yêu cầu hiểu biết về XML. ]
1 cột - Áp dụng bố cục một cột cho trang danh mục
2 cột có thanh bên trái - Áp dụng bố cục hai cột có thanh bên trái cho trang danh mục
2 cột với thanh bên phải - Áp dụng bố cục hai cột với thanh bên phải cho trang danh mục
3 cột - Áp dụng bố cục ba cột cho trang danh mục
Trang – Chiều rộng đầy đủ - [Yêu cầu Trình tạo trang] Áp dụng bố cục toàn chiều rộng cho các trang CMS cho trang danh mục
Thể loại – Chiều rộng đầy đủ - [Yêu cầu trình tạo trang] Áp dụng bố cục toàn chiều rộng cho các trang thể loại cho trang thể loại
Sản phẩm – Chiều rộng đầy đủ - [Yêu cầu trình tạo trang] Áp dụng bố cục toàn chiều rộng cho các trang sản phẩm cho trang danh mục. Cập nhật bố cục tùy chỉnhLiệt kê các tệp cập nhật bố cục tùy chỉnh có sẵn trên máy chủ. Chọn bản cập nhật bố cục tùy chỉnh mà bạn muốn áp dụng cho danh mục. Áp dụng thiết kế cho sản phẩmKhi được chọn, áp dụng cài đặt tùy chỉnh cho tất cả sản phẩm trong danh mục. Phương pháp thay thế cần thiết cho Mã nguồn mở Magento []

Phần Cập nhật thiết kế theo lịch trình xác định phạm vi ngày áp dụng thiết kế tùy chỉnh cho các trang danh mục

Từ Magento 2. 3. 4, Vùng văn bản cập nhật bố cục tùy chỉnh đã bị xóa khỏi trang chỉnh sửa danh mục của bảng quản trị, trang chỉnh sửa sản phẩm và trang chỉnh sửa cms để loại bỏ khả năng Thực thi mã từ xa [RCE]. Thay thế Textarea bằng bộ chọn

Trước đó, bạn có thể thêm trực tiếp đoạn mã XML cho thực thể cụ thể từ phần phụ trợ nhưng từ Magento 2. 3. 4 tính năng mới đã được thêm vào. Bạn cần tạo tệp XML ở cấp độ chủ đề hoặc mô-đun của mình và gán tệp XML cho bộ chọn Cập nhật bố cục tùy chỉnh

1. Trang chuyên mục
Hãy tạo một xử lý XML cụ thể cho trang Danh mục
Bạn phải tạo một tệp riêng cho từng danh mục mà bạn muốn sử dụng bản cập nhật bố cục tùy chỉnh

Bạn có thể được chỉ định tệp XML cập nhật bố cục từ bảng Quản trị,
Chuyển đến Danh mục -> Danh mục
Chọn Bất kỳ [Túi] Danh mục, Nhấp vào Phần Thiết kế
Chọn Tay cầm bố cục từ Trường cập nhật bố cục tùy chỉnh

Xử lý bố cục mặc định là Không có bản cập nhật nào được chọn. Nếu bạn đã tạo bố cục tùy chỉnh cho danh mục cụ thể, Bạn có thể thấy trình điều khiển bố cục mới cho danh mục

Cú pháp xử lý bố cục mặc định cho trang danh mục
catalog_category_view_selectable_CATEGORYID_CATEGORYNAME. xml

Ví dụ: Bạn muốn xóa phần chân trang khỏi Danh mục túi của dữ liệu mẫu Magento gốc. Bạn cần tạo một xử lý cập nhật bố cục cho Danh mục Túi xách
CATEGORYID cho biết id Danh mục Túi [4]
CATEGORYNAME cho biết tên danh mục tùy chỉnh của bạn, chúng tôi đã lấy tên là túi. [sử dụng một từ duy nhất cho tên danh mục không có dấu cách, dấu gạch ngang hoặc dấu gạch dưới]
Tay cầm thực tế của bạn sẽ là,
catalog_category_view_selectable_4_bags. xml

Bây giờ, bạn phải tạo một tệp XML ở cấp chủ đề hoặc mô-đun với đường dẫn bên dưới,

Theme Level: app/design/frontend///Magento_Catalog/layout/catalog_category_view_selectable_4_bags.xml
Hoặc là
Cấp độ mô-đun. app/code/Jesadiya/Demo/view/frontend/layout/catalog_category_view_selectable_4_bags. xml



    
        
    

Bây giờ, hãy chuyển đến Trang danh mục túi của bảng quản trị, Chọn tay cầm bố trí túi từ bộ chọn và Lưu danh mục

bố cục tùy chỉnh-cập nhật-XML Magento 2. 3. 4

Xóa bộ nhớ cache và kiểm tra mặt tiền cửa hàng với trang Túi. Khối chân trang sẽ bị xóa khỏi trang Danh mục

Làm cách nào để thêm bố cục tùy chỉnh cho danh mục trong Magento 2?

Để thay đổi bố cục danh mục, đi tới Sản phẩm -> Danh mục -> Chọn Danh mục mong muốn, chuyển đến tab Thiết kế và chọn tùy chọn mong muốn từ trình đơn thả xuống Bố cục.

Làm cách nào để thêm cập nhật bố cục tùy chỉnh trong Magento 2?

Chọn một trang CMS cụ thể và mở trang đó ở chế độ chỉnh sửa. Mở rộng tab Thiết kế, trong trường Cập nhật bố cục tùy chỉnh, hãy chọn bản cập nhật bố cục mà bạn muốn áp dụng cho trang. Nhấn nút Lưu .

Làm cách nào để tạo trình xử lý bố cục trong Magento 2?

Trước khi viết mã, hãy viết ra những gì chúng ta cần làm. .
Kiểm tra bố cục trang hiện tại là dành cho danh mục
Kiểm tra danh mục trong sổ đăng ký của Magento
Lấy bản cập nhật bố cục từ sự kiện
Thêm tay cầm tùy chỉnh dựa trên thuộc tính danh mục [chúng tôi sẽ kiểm tra Chế độ hiển thị]

Làm cách nào để xóa XML hình ảnh danh mục trong Magento 2?

Danh mục > danh mục > nội dung phần > Hình ảnh danh mục> trên hình ảnh bạn có thể tìm thấy biểu tượng xóa , sử dụng biểu tượng đó bạn có thể xóa hình ảnh. Ảnh chụp màn hình PFA để bạn tham khảo.

Chủ Đề